Traumatic injury to the tracheobronchial tree requires prompt, accurate diagnosis for optimum surgical treatment. The radiologist is in a pivotal position either to suggest this diagnosis or to initiate further investigation to establish it. Three cases of traumatic bronchial rupture illustrate the spectrum of radiologic findings and document the value of tomography in confirming this diagnosis.
